Hershey to bring in ‘Jolly Rancher’ to India

December 05, 2013 07:07 pm | Updated 07:07 pm IST - NEW DELHI

The Hershey Company on Thursday said it will launch its popular sweet brand ‘Jolly Rancher’ sweet brand in India.

India is the first international market for the Jolly Rancher brand outside of North America in the brand’s 65-year history, the company said, adding the Indian confectionery market is one of the fastest-growing markets in the world with a strong double-digit annual compound growth rate of about 18 percent.

The New York Exchange-listed company is present in India through wholly-owned subsidiary Hershey India Private Ltd.

ADVERTISEMENT

Atul Razdan, General Manager, Marketing, Sweets and Refreshments, for Hershey India said, “We’ve tailored our new Jolly Rancher products for India to appeal, specifically, to local palates with bold, fruity flavours that are unlike any other candy available in the market.”

The company is manufacturing the products in its Chittoor plant in India.
